WebAffinity chromatography (AC) separates proteins on the basis of a reversible interaction between the target protein and a specific ligand attached to a chromatography base matrix. WebCon A Sepharose ® 4B with immobilized Concanavalin A is an affinity chromatography media for capture of glycosylated biomolecules including glycoproteins and glycolipids. Stronger affinity for α-D-glucose than α-D-mannose. Con A Sepharose ® is Concanavalin A coupled to Sepharose ® 4B by the cyanogen bromide method. WebChromatography modeling.
